confused about tops
Hi,
I just got my 4door jk with a hardtop. I'd like to replace the top with a simple mesh cover for shade only and the more I look at all those accessory sites the more confused I get!
I'm looking for a cover that would give shade to both rows of seats, is easy to put on and preferably does not need a soft top kit to secure it onto.
What is the best/easiet option out there?
Thanks!

Check into the Bestop mesh safari top. The advantage with having the soft top is that you can get something approximating a seal at the doors by leaving the door frames and doors installed. But, with a mesh top I expect you're not trying to keep rain out. LOL. I think it would look great without the doors. I have the Mopar top, but it's not mesh. I went with it because they have a version that doesn't require the door frames to reduce flapping. But, I'm guessing that's much less of an issue with a mesh top.

I have the mesh one, it really helps block the sun. you can strap it to the roll bars, without having the soft top door surrounds. being mesh I do not have the flapping issues that others have reported when fastening it in this manner

I don't have the Bestop, but I'm certain that you do. The Mopar Sunbonnet top (which has the header bar built-in) comes off very easily--just attaches to the two brackets that the Freedom Tops attach to above the windshield. Obviously, it must be out of the way to reinstall the Freedom Tops.

The header is actually attached (via snaps) to the fabric part. You undo two little clips and remove it with the fabric (as easily as removeing the clips for the front part of the hard top. The hardest part of the 5min or less removal or install (maybe 10 min install without breaking a sweat) is removing/connecting all the straps. I usually roll mine up starting with the header and place it between the wheelwells and the back seat when not in use. It fits like it was meant to go there.
